What does the acronym ASIC stand for in the context of Bitcoin mining?

Explanation:
In the context of Bitcoin mining, the acronym ASIC stands for Application Specific Integrated Circuit. These are specialized hardware devices designed specifically for the purpose of mining cryptocurrencies, particularly Bitcoin. Unlike general-purpose hardware like CPUs or GPUs, ASICs are optimized to perform the specific calculations required for mining at a much higher efficiency and speed. This optimization allows miners using ASICs to process more hashes per second than those using traditional computer hardware, making them the preferred choice for competitive mining environments. ASICs are purpose-built, meaning that they are engineered to perform only the tasks related to Bitcoin mining. This specialization results in better performance and energy efficiency compared to other types of hardware, making them essential components of modern Bitcoin mining operations. The development and deployment of ASICs have significantly transformed the mining landscape, leading to the establishment of large-scale mining operations that dominate the Bitcoin network's hash power.
